Hello Tony Romo EraBorn in Bedford and going to high school in Allen, Texas (both suburbs of Dallas), you’d think Kyler Murray was a born and bred Cowboys fan. But, this was apparently not the case.
Hanging out with Sports Illustrated for the release of his magazine cover with FaZe Clan on Thursday, Murray was asked about his NFL allegiances as a kid.
His answer to to whether or not he was a Cowboys fan was a resounding “(expletive) no!”
“They were always a**,” the Cardinals QB said.
He later elaborated that he was a fan of the Minnesota Vikings growing up.
(The Cowboys meet Murray and the Cards twice this year.)
